Reporting to the Manager of Content Development, you will own the content strategy for our Platform and Analytics products, transforming complex technical information into engaging and easily digestible training resources.
WHAT YOU'LL DO:
Architect and build a world-class content library: You will design, develop, and continuously refine the enablement content for Snowflake's Platform and Analytics offerings. Drive a proactive content strategy: Move beyond ad-hoc requests and take a disciplined approach to building a comprehensive content strategy for Platform and Analytics. You will anticipate the needs of the field and deliver timely, impactful resources. Forge strong internal partnerships: Become a trusted partner to our product marketing and engineering teams. By immersing yourself in the product roadmap and external messaging, you will ensure our enablement content is always current, accurate, and aligned with our go-to-market strategy. Elevate our field training programs: Be a key contributor to major internal training events, including our Snow Surge webinar series, Sales Kick-Off (SKO), and TechUp. Your content will be central to the success of these high-profile initiatives. Collaborate for continuous improvement: Work closely with the Global Solution Engineering and Sales Everboarding teams to gather feedback and continuously enhance the Platform and Analytics training programs, tailoring content to meet the specific needs of different sales segments. Champion best-in-class content creation: You will manage the entire lifecycle of your content, from creation and documentation in our internal repository to the design of engaging courses in Articulate Rise. Your commitment to quality will ensure our sales teams have access to the best possible product and competitive intelligence.
WHAT YOU'LL BRING:
Deep technical expertise: A strong command of the Snowflake Platform and our Analytics solutions is essential. A passion for teaching and enablement: Proven experience in a technical training or enablement role. A seasoned professional: A minimum of 5 years of related experience, with a focus on enterprise software, sales engineering, or enablement within the data technology space. A strategic mindset: The ability to translate business objectives into a compelling content strategy and execute on it. Exceptional communication and collaboration skills: The ability to work effectively with a diverse range of internal stakeholders and cross-functional partners to deliver high-quality programs. You are a master of building relationships and aligning teams. Proven content creation experience: Demonstrated ability to design and build engaging and effective training materials. Agility and a results-oriented approach: The ability to thrive in a fast-paced, high-growth environment, managing multiple priorities and meeting deadlines without sacrificing quality. A bachelor's degree or equivalent experience.

For jobs located in the United States, please visit the job posting on the Snowflake Careers Site for salary and benefits information: careers.snowflake.com The following represents the expected range of compensation for this role:
- The estimated base salary range for this role is $154,000 - $215,200.
- Additionally, this role is eligible to participate in Snowflake's bonus and equity plan.
The successful candidate's starting salary will be determined based on permissible, non-discriminatory factors such as skills, experience, and geographic location. This role is also eligible for a competitive benefits package that includes: medical, dental, vision, life, and disability insurance; 401(k) retirement plan; flexible spending & health savings account; at least 12 paid holidays; paid time off; parental leave; employee assistance program; and other company benefits.
